The MINI Sport Pack has been announced to add sports suspension and an aerodynamic kit to the new MINI 3-door and 5-door. Costs from £3,300.

It’s a big claim, but MINI say that adding their new MINI Sport pack will increase the residual value of your car by as much as 25 per cent.
The list of additional kit is quite impressive – in addition to the Chilli Pack – including bonnet stripes, sport suspension, 17″ Track Spoke alloys, John Cooper Works steering wheel and a JCW spoiler (full list below).
With prices for the Sport Pack on the Mini One and One D at £4,500, Cooper and Cooper D at £4,300 and Cooper S and Cooper SD at £3,300, it means the Sport Pack equipped MINI range kicks off at £18,250 for the three-door MINI One and tops out at £23,350 for the five-door Cooper SD.
They’re big prices, but if you really do get a 25 per cent lift in residual values it could be a no-cost choice.
MINI Sport Pack Equipment
Cloth/leather Diamond upholstery
Multi-function controls for steering wheel
Bonnet stripes
Sport suspension (not for MINI One & One D)
17″ Track Spoke alloy wheels in silver or black
John Cooper Works steering wheel
John Cooper Works roof spoiler
John Cooper Works aerodynamic kit
Floor mats
Passenger seat height adjustment
Storage compartment pack
Anthracite headlining
Piano Black interior trim
MINI Excitement Pack
MINI Driving Modes
Rain sensor & automatic headlight activation
Air conditioning, dual-zone automatic
Interior lights pack
MINI John Cooper Works door sill finishers
